Job description

Title: Senior Electrical Engineer ( Oil & Gas)

Location: Baytown, TX (On-Site)

Duration: 12 months contract

Roles & Responsibilities:

  • The Electrical Engineer, as part of the Engineering Services department at a major integrated petrochemical manufacturing facility, is responsible for the optimization, troubleshooting, and design of a wide variety of electrical equipment.
  • This involves time in the field ensuring that the installed electrical equipment contributes to safe, environmentally sound, reliable, and profitable operations.
  • Maintain close contact with operations, maintenance, engineering, and project development to identify and implement electrical equipment repairs and reliability improvements
  • Design and specify electrical equipment such as motors, breakers, relays, generators, substations, buses, starters, transformers, and other industrial electrical equipment (480V to 230kV)
  • Coordinate projects for new or replacement equipment among engineering, maintenance, and operations
  • Commissioning, startup assistance, and support of electrical systems with maintenance personnel
  • Serve as an electrical technology expert liaison between project engineers, plant maintenance, and operations personnel
  • Supports and interfaces with business teams to maintain and improve electrical reliability while reducing maintenance costs.
  • Participates in screening, optimization, basic design preparation for electric power systems
  • Develops project scoping, design and detail specifications for electric power systems
  • Monitors Engineering Quality Control and leads contractor's electrical work to ensure consistency with project specifications and guidelines
  • Support preparation of Design Basis Memorandums and develop Specifications
  • Provides technical support and services to operating facilities
  • Performs power systems simulations and analyses, including load flow, short circuit, motor starting and reacceleration, arc flash, transient stability and relay coordination
  • Updates Company practices and specifications
  • Applies customer's Global Practices, Design Practices, General Information and Instructions, codes and standards in support of projects during the detailed design phase
  • Participates actively in the Electrical Community of Practice
  • Participates in incident investigations in support of assets
  • Performs Risk Assessments and develops Equipment Strategies in support of assets
  • Manages electrical area classification for assets within the facility supported

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Bachelor of Science or Master of Science degree in Electrical Engineering
  • Demonstrated experience in petrochemical industry with power systems as an Electrical Engineer
  • 10+ years' experience preferred.
